TNT shoots for the 2023 PBA Governors’ Cup finals and finish off two-time defending champion Barangay Ginebra on Friday night at the Smart-Araneta Coliseum.

The Tropang Giga take on the Gin Kings at 5:45 p.m. as they gun for a third straight win in this finals series at the Big Dome.

For the first time in the finals series, a team won back-to-back games with TNT beating Ginebra, 104-95, last Wednesday to grab a 3-2 advantage.

TNT is now aiming for its ninth PBA title and its first Governors' Cup crown at the expense of Ginebra, which won four of the last five championships in the conference.

TNT coach Jojo Lastimosa, however, said beating Ginebra will be a challenge for his team, knowing what his counterpart Tim Cone is capable of doing.

“I’ve been with Tim around so much for so long that I think that I know him really well and his coaching style. But he has secrets that I don’t know. Last time I was with him was in 2011. Medyo matagal na. Maybe he has picked up plays here and there,” said Lastimosa.

“It will be an accomplishment. It will be an honor if I beat him in the series. But it’s a long series. A lot can still happen. Close out games are really, really hard,” said Lastimosa.

A big question mark for Game Six is the status of Justin Brownlee, who suffered from food poisoning and left Game Five prematurely.

Brownlee has already been discharged from the hospital but his fitness for the match is still unknown.

    Cone said Ginebra definitely needs Brownlee to enhance Ginebra’s chances of winning Game Six.

    “We made some turnovers down the stretch. We couldn’t rebound with Justin not there. That’s the story of the game… Now it’s twice to beat. We are going to go out. Hopefully, Justin would be better after being in the hospital,” said Cone.

    TNT import Rondae Hollis-Jefferson is determined to close the finals series in his quest to win his first-ever professional title.

    “It’s all about taking that step to put your mind in advance mode. They might adjust to this. They might do this. This is working, they might stay to that. Thinking about those little things. And at the end of the day, to execute offensively and defensively,” said Hollis-Jefferson.
